Paze Hits Major Milestone: 125 million Credit and Debit Cardholders Can Check Out Online

Published

on

New online checkout solution available to credit and debit cardholders at Bank of America, Capital One, Chase, PNC Bank, Truist, U.S. Bank, and Wells Fargo 

New general manager to lead next phase of Paze SM growth  

NEW YORK, Oct. 1,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— Paze SM, a new online checkout solution from Early Warning Services, LLC., (EWS) is now available for more than 125 million credit and debit cards across the United States. To enroll, eligible customers must activate their Paze digital wallet from their participating banks’ mobile app or when checking out at a participating online retailer. In addition to this milestone, Serge Elkiner joins as Paze general manager to lead the product into its next phase of growth. 

Paze, a reimagined digital wallet offered by banks and credit unions, will combine all eligible credit and debit cards into a single wallet, eliminating the need for manual entry at online checkout. The online checkout solution also provides added security by tokenizing credit and debit card numbers, meaning the 16-digit card number is not shared with the merchant when consumers use Paze to check out. 

Paze was designed with both merchants and shoppers in mind, helping to solve key pain points in the online shopping experience. Checking out with Paze is an easy and convenient experience with no manual card entry, no new passwords to remember1, and no need to download third-party payment applications. With its intuitive interface, Paze empowers consumers to navigate the online checkout process with ease and convenience, while helping to reduce cart abandonment for merchants. 

To date, Paze has provisioned more than 125 million credit and debit cards across Bank of America, Capital One, Chase, PNC Bank, Truist, U.S. Bank, and Wells Fargo.

Xojo 2024 Release 3 Adds the Power of Preemptive Threads, Android Tablet Support

Published

on

By

AUSTIN, Texas, Oct. 1,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— Xojo, Inc., the developers behind Xojo—a powerful cross-platform development tool and programming language—proudly announce the immediate availability of Xojo 2024 Release 3. This release adds preemptive threading, a highly anticipated feature that offers significant performance improvements, Web improvements and support for Android tablets.

With over 200 new features and improvements, this new release not only offers the power of preemptive threads to Xojo users, it also includes Code Editor improvements, multiple Web updates and new Android features, including tablet support. Kem Tekinay, RegEx enthusiast and Xojo MVP, commented, “Xojo has introduced preemptive threads, and it’s a game-changer. With trademark simplicity that belies its power, this new feature will let users go in new directions for faster and more responsive apps by building on an already familiar foundation.”

New Features and Updates:
Preemptive Threading
Code Editor improvements: Row highlighting, command bar button for Standardize Format, and Syntax Help area size control
Web now uses Bootstrap v5.3.3 and Bootstrap Icons v1.11.3
Web supports adding CSS classes to controls
macOS Popovers can be resized
Windows HTMLViewer can now access camera and microphone
iOS Picture can access EXIF metadata
Android tablet support
Android improved Declare support
Android RegEx classes

Availability
Xojo is a cross-platform development tool for building native applications for macOS, Windows, Linux, iOS, Android, the web, and Raspberry Pi. Xojo is free to use for learning and development. A license is required to build most applications; building Linux Desktop and Console apps and Raspberry Pi apps is included in the Xojo IDE. Pricing begins at $99 for a single desktop platform. Building cross-platform desktop, mobile, or web applications is $399. Xojo Pro and Pro Plus packages are available from $799 and up, offering increased support and resources for professional developers. Xojo offers special packages for educators and students. MIT Technology Review Recognizes Gogoro as a Top 15 Climate Tech Company to Watch for 2nd Consecutive Year

Published

on

By

MIT Technology Review’s ’15 Climate Tech Companies to Watch’ annual list recognizes companies that are developing innovative new technologies or scaling existing ones to address climate change.

CAMBRIDGE, Mass., Oct. 1,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— Gogoro Inc. (Nasdaq: GGR), a global technology leader in battery swapping ecosystems that enable sustainable mobility solutions for cities, today was recognized by MIT Technology Review as a ’15 Climate Tech Companies to Watch’ for the second consecutive year. The announcement was made at the EmTech MIT Conference held at the MIT Media Lab in Cambridge, Massachusetts.

MIT Technology Review’s annual list recognizes companies that are developing innovative new technologies or scaling existing ones to address climate change. To access the 2024 ’15 Climate Tech Companies to Watch’ list, visit technologyreview.com.

“Gogoro stood out for successfully deploying electric scooters and battery swapping across Taiwan and is expanding elsewhere,” said Amy Nordrum, Executive Editor, Operations, MIT Technology Review. “But also—its battery swap stations are good for the grid, because they serve as a backup power source for the Taiwan power grid.That’s why we’re featuring them for the second year running.”

“Gogoro battery swapping is transforming urban two-wheel transportation, making it smarter, more sustainable, and accessible for everyone. With over 630 million battery swaps completed, we have successfully saved more than one million tons of CO2,” said Henry Chiang, CEO of Gogoro. “We are grateful to MIT Technology Review for including us in their prestigious list for the second consecutive year.
